*Infra-Man* (1975) is a campy, high-energy Chinese science fiction and martial arts film directed by Shan Hua. The film follows a scientist named Dr. Sun, who transforms a man named Wei Cheng into Infra-Man, a super-powered hero with incredible strength, speed, and advanced weaponry, in order to battle an evil, monstrous queen named Princess Dragon Mom and her army of mutants. As Dragon Mom attempts to take over the world, Infra-Man must use his powers to fight her terrifying creatures, including giant robots, mutant beasts, and her own monstrous warriors. The film is a colorful, action-packed blend of superhero tropes, kaiju (giant monster) battles, and kung fu, featuring over-the-top special effects, cheesy costumes, and a sense of playful absurdity. *Infra-Man* is often described as a "Hong Kong version of *Kamen Rider*," with its zany tone and influence from both tokusatsu superhero series and kaiju films, making it a beloved cult classic for fans of kitschy genre cinema.
